In a sea of notch-sporting smartphones, one brand wants to ditch the trend and provide nothing but a full-display experience. No, we’re not talking about the Vivo APEX; instead, it is Lenovo who is ready to take the challenge of making an all-display phone with the Z5.
While the teaser image looks promising, we’re still puzzled at how Lenovo will pull off a phone boasting of a 95% screen-to-body ratio. The Mi MIX 2/2S, which has a screen-to-body ratio of 91.3%, manages to go notch-free by placing the front camera in an awkward position.
According to Lenovo Vice President Chang Cheng, they utilized four technological breakthroughs and 18 patented technologies to make the all-display look possible. Our speculation is that they possibly found a way to place the front camera behind the display, along with utilizing an in-display fingerprint scanner.
For now, we have to wait and see how Lenovo will pull off the all-screen display.
